– 6’0 | Prep Dig #4
DeWese made a big impact as a freshman for her Lake team during the high school season. The multi-sport athlete has good athleticism and is physical at the net. She has good size at 6’0 and a natural style in her ability to perform skills effectively and with ease. She has a big arm swing that can produce a lot of pace and as she looks most comfortable and in rhythm on the right side, she can also score from the left with good power.
Gretchen Sigman
Gretchen
Sigman
5'10" | RS
Springfield | 2024
State
OH
– 5’10 | Prep Dig #11
As a freshman, Sigman was the primary offensive threat for her Springfield team. She averaged 3.2 kills per set with her best opportunities and effectiveness coming from the right side. She has good elevation and a big left arm swing that she can control in order to move the ball around. Her footwork is fluid on both sides of the court and if she can develop a bigger double-arm lift at the end of her approach pattern she will add elevation and balance in the air. She also contributed 2.4 blocks and 7.6 digs per match this past fall season.
Melana Bigelow
Melana
Bigelow
5'11" | RS
Turpin | 2024
State
OH
– 6’0 | Prep Dig #17
Bigelow continues to grow her skill set and effectiveness as an attacker throughout the current club season competing for one of the best U15 teams in the country at NKYVC. She has contributed among the heavy arms on this team in helping them earn an Open-level bid to the upcoming Girls’ Junior National Championships later this summer. She has much more time to continue developing her arm in addition to other skills at the net to be an effective defender on the right pin. She has a lot of potential and should raise her stock going forward.
Taylor Dushane
Taylor
Dushane
5'10" | RS
Hayes | 2024
State
OH
– 5’10 | Prep Dig #27
Dushane is a steady contributor on the floor and has a good skill foundation to be able to contribute in a variety of areas. She doesn’t have much wasted movement in her approach work as she gets her feet to the ball well to be able to take a healthy swing. She can swing from the left side, fill in the middle if needed, and currently plays a lot at opposite for a really good Elite 15 Black team. She is one to watch to see how she progresses going forward and if she can increase foot speed and elevation to be more of an impact at the net.
Aubrey Miranda
Aubrey
Miranda
5'7" | RS
Medina | 2024
State
OH
– 5’7 | Prep Dig #40
At just 5’7, Miranda has good momentum build and lift that allows her to use her aggressive left arm well. She can score from any location across the net and is relentless in her aggressiveness at the top of her jump. She shows good arm control to be able to challenge the block, hit through the gaps, and swing off speed. She took a fair amount of swings for her Medina team during the high school season and should see an uptick in her opportunities as she continues into her second season.
